对机器编程需要什么语言

worktile 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    机器编程需要使用特定的编程语言来实现。不同的编程语言适用于不同的应用场景和目的。以下是一些常见的用于机器编程的编程语言:

    1. C语言:C语言是一种通用的高级编程语言,被广泛用于嵌入式系统和底层开发。它具有强大的性能和对硬件访问的灵活性,适用于开发驱动程序、操作系统等低级应用。

    2. C++语言:C++是C语言的扩展,支持面向对象的编程。它适用于开发大型软件系统,具有良好的性能和高效的内存管理。C++广泛应用于游戏开发、图形界面设计等领域。

    3. Python:Python是一种易学易用的高级编程语言,被广泛应用于机器学习、科学计算和自动化领域。它具有简洁的语法和丰富的库,可快速开发原型和实现复杂的算法。

    4. Java:Java是一种跨平台的编程语言,适用于开发网络应用和大规模软件系统。它具有丰富的库和强大的安全性,广泛应用于企业级应用、手机应用和大数据处理。

    5. JavaScript:JavaScript是一种用于网页开发的脚本语言,主要用于实现交互式网页和动态效果。它在浏览器中直接执行,可以与HTML和CSS相互配合,实现丰富的用户界面和网页功能。

    6. MATLAB:MATLAB是一种用于数值计算和科学工程的编程语言,主要用于数据分析、信号处理和模拟等领域。它具有丰富的库和强大的数学功能,方便进行复杂的科学计算。

    7. Ruby:Ruby是一种简洁优雅的脚本语言,适用于快速开发Web应用。它具有易读易写的语法和强大的面向对象特性,被广泛应用于Ruby on Rails等Web框架。

    除了以上列举的编程语言,还有许多其他的编程语言可供选择,如R语言、Go语言、Swift语言等。选择适合自己需求和项目要求的编程语言是非常重要的,同时也要根据个人的编程经验和学习能力来决定。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    机器编程是指使用编程语言来编写机器的操作指令,使机器能够根据这些指令实现特定的功能。在机器编程中,有许多不同的编程语言可以选择。以下是一些常用的用于机器编程的编程语言:

    1. 机器语言:机器语言是一种底层的编程语言,直接使用二进制代码来表示机器指令。由于机器语言是与硬件直接相关的,所以在可移植性和易用性方面有一定的限制,一般只由计算机专业人员使用。

    2. 汇编语言:汇编语言是一种较低级别的编程语言,使用助记符来表示机器指令。汇编语言相对于机器语言来说,更易于阅读和编写,但仍然需要与特定的硬件结构相对应。

    3. C语言:C语言是一种广泛使用的高级编程语言,它结合了低级语言和高级语言的特性,既可以实现底层的操作,又具有较高的可移植性和可扩展性。C语言对于机器编程来说是非常重要的一种编程语言。

    4. C++语言:C++是在C语言的基础上发展起来的一种面向对象的编程语言。C++在C语言的基础上增加了面向对象的特性,使得编写和维护复杂的机器程序更加方便和高效。

    5. Python语言:Python是一种高级编程语言,具有简洁、易读、可扩展的特点。Python语言在机器编程中广泛应用于控制和自动化领域,以及机器学习和人工智能等领域。

    总结起来,机器编程可以使用机器语言、汇编语言、C语言、C++语言和Python语言等多种编程语言来实现,选择使用哪种编程语言取决于具体的应用需求和开发人员的个人喜好和熟悉程度。在选择编程语言时,开发人员需要考虑编程语言的易用性、性能、可移植性和扩展性等因素。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在机器编程领域,有许多不同的编程语言可以用于编写和控制机器。在选择使用哪种编程语言时,需要考虑以下几个因素:

    1. 机器类型:不同类型的机器可能需要使用不同的编程语言。例如,对于计算机视觉任务,可以使用Python或C++编程语言;对于机器人控制,可以使用C或C++编程语言;对于工业自动化,可以使用PLC编程语言等。因此,首先要确定机器的类型和应用领域,以确定合适的编程语言。

    2. 编程技能水平:不同编程语言的学习曲线和复杂度有所不同。如果是新手或者没有编程经验,可能推荐使用易于学习和理解的编程语言,例如Python。如果已经具备一定的编程基础,可以选择更底层的编程语言,例如C或C++。

    3. 平台和生态系统支持:不同的编程语言在不同的平台和生态系统中有不同的支持和工具。确保所选编程语言在目标平台上有良好的支持和丰富的开发工具,可以提高开发效率和代码质量。

    下面列举一些在机器编程中常用的编程语言:

    1. Python:Python是一种强大而易于学习的编程语言,拥有丰富的机器学习和人工智能库,例如Tensorflow和PyTorch。它还被广泛用于计算机视觉、自然语言处理和数据分析等领域。

    2. C/C++:C/C++是一种低级别的编程语言,适用于对性能和效率有要求的应用。它们广泛用于嵌入式系统和实时控制。

    3. PLC编程语言:PLC编程语言是为了编写可编程逻辑控制器(PLC)程序而设计的。其中最常见的语言是Ladder Logic(梯形图)和Structured Text(结构化文本)。

    4. MATLAB:MATLAB是一种数值计算和科学编程语言,广泛应用于信号处理、控制系统设计和机器学习等领域。

    5. Java:Java是一种通用编程语言,被广泛应用于企业级应用开发。在机器编程中,Java可以用于开发大规模的分布式系统,例如机器群集和物联网应用。

    在选择适合的编程语言时,可以考虑以上因素并仔细评估每个编程语言的优缺点,以确保最佳的开发效果。此外,应通过阅读文档、参考书籍和教程等学习资源,提高对所选编程语言的理解和熟练程度。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部